Finding a reliable download for the LabVIEW Runtime Engine (RTE) version 7.1 can feel like a trip back in time. Released in the early 2000s, this version remains a cornerstone for legacy industrial systems and older automated test setups.

If you are trying to run an executable (.exe) built in LabVIEW 7.1 on a modern machine, or if you're maintaining a vintage lab setup, here is everything you need to know about sourcing and installing this specific runtime. What is the LabVIEW 7.1 Runtime Engine?

The LabVIEW Runtime Engine is a library of shared files required to run any application or shared library created with the LabVIEW 7.1 Development System.

Unlike the full development environment, the RTE is free and does not require a license. However, it is version-specific. An application built in LabVIEW 7.1 will not run with the LabVIEW 8.0 or 2024 runtime; it specifically looks for the 7.1 binaries. Where to Download LabVIEW 7.1 RTE (High Quality & Safe)

Physical Media: Many engineers still have the "LabVIEW 7.1 Platform" CDs. If you are in a high-security or offline environment, this is often the most "high quality" source available. Compatibility Warnings Before you install, keep these technical hurdles in mind:

Operating System: LabVIEW 7.1 was designed for Windows 2000 and XP. While it can sometimes run on Windows 7 or 10 using "Compatibility Mode," it is not officially supported and may lead to crashes or "DLL not found" errors.

32-bit vs 64-bit: This version is strictly 32-bit. It must be installed on a 32-bit OS or within the SysWOW64 environment of a 64-bit Windows system.

Missing Dependencies: Often, the RTE isn't enough. If your application controls hardware (like a DAQ card or GPIB interface), you will also need the legacy versions of NI-DAQ or NI-488.2 drivers that are compatible with version 7.1. How to Install Download the installer (usually a .exe or a zipped folder).

Right-click the installer and select "Run as Administrator."

Follow the prompts. If you are on Windows 10, the installer may ask to install .NET Framework 2.0/3.5; allow this, as old NI installers often rely on these early frameworks.

Reboot your system to ensure the environment variables are correctly set.

For Windows 10/11 (64-bit):

  1. Right-click the installer -> Properties -> Compatibility tab.
  2. Check "Run this program in compatibility mode for:" -> Windows 7 or Windows XP (Service Pack 3).
  3. Check "Run this program as an administrator."
  4. Disable Real-time Antivirus temporarily (false positives on old installers are common).
  5. Run LVRTE71.exe (or similar name).
  6. Accept the license. During installation, choose "Complete," not "Custom."
